About Powin:

Powin Energy is a leading producer of utility scale modular battery energy storage system (complete with a patented, advanced, cloud-based monitoring/control system). That means we build power plants out of batteries that put coal and gas generators out of business and enable sustainable viability for renewable energy sources like solar and wind.

Powin is, and will continue to be, one of a handful of companies that will provide the equipment necessary to make this happen. Powin has distinct competitive advantages: cost-effectiveness; reliability; scalability; deploy-ability; and operational sophistication. Every day we work to ensure that we maintain these competitive advantages and our position as a global leader in providing turnkey, battery energy storage solutions for utility-scale, commercial and industrial, and microgrid applications.

Summary:

The Director of Environmental Health and Safety (EHS) will be responsible for developing, implementing, and overseeing comprehensive environmental, health, and safety programs to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and promote a safe working environment for all employees. This role will collaborate with various departments to identify and mitigate potential hazards, implement best practices, and drive a culture of safety throughout the organization and with the contract manufacturers and suppliers the company works with.

Develop and implement company-wide environmental health and safety policies, procedures, and programs in accordance with local, state, and federal regulations

Conduct regular risk assessments and audits to identify potential hazards in the workplace and develop strategies to mitigate risks

Provide leadership and guidance to EHS staff and collaborate with cross-functional teams to promote safety awareness and compliance

Establish and maintain relationships with regulatory agencies, ensuring compliance with permits, licenses, and reporting requirements

Oversee development and delivery of comprehensive EHS training programs for employees and managers to increase awareness and promote a culture of safety

Monitor and analyze EHS performance metrics and implement continuous improvement initiatives to enhance safety performance

Oversee and assist with investigation of incidents, accidents, and near misses, identifying root causes and implementing corrective and preventive actions to prevent recurrence

Manage emergency response and crisis management procedures, including coordination with relevant stakeholders and authorities

Stay informed about emerging EHS regulations, trends, and best practices, and recommend appropriate actions to ensure compliance and improve EHS performance

Prepare and present regular reports to senior management on EHS performance, initiatives, and areas for improvement

Performs other duties as assigned

Qualifications:

Bachelor's degree in environmental health and safety, occupational health and safety, engineering, or a related field, or equivalent relevant experience

Professional certification in environmental, health, and safety (e.g., Certified Safety Professional (CSP), Certified Industrial Hygienist (CIH), Certified Environmental Professional (CEP)) is highly desirable

7+ years of experience in environmental health and safety leadership roles, manufacturing environment experience required

In-depth knowledge of local, state, and federal EHS regulations, including OSHA, EPA, and other relevant agencies

Strong leadership and interpersonal skills with the ability to influence and engage stakeholders at all levels of the organization

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to identify trends, analyze data, and develop effective solutions

Proven track record of developing and implementing successful EHS programs and initiatives

Effective communication skills, including the ability to deliver presentations and trainings to diverse audiences

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ment

Ability to work cross functionally, including explaining designs and concepts to all levels of employees and management

Demonstrated ability to communicate professionally verbally and in writing

Excellent time management skills, including multi-tasking, ability to prioritize, meet deadlines, follow up and attention to details

Proficient in MS Office applications (Excel, Word, PowerPoint)

Willingness and ability to travel to support contract manufacturers, suppliers, etc., during start-ups, changes, customer visits, etc.

Able to work flexible hours to support international teams, as needed
